My perfection

A Poem by Kimberley Hawker
"

The things that warm my heart the most.

"
Tired eyes gazing at my love sleeping innocently beside me
Fresh air I inhale as I toss and turn between the messy linen
My feet dragging against the chilly carpet
A blanket of cold air over me, as I slowly walk towards the kitchen
The cup of coffee that touches my lips as I take that first sip
Rain pouring through the mist, pattering against the window
Autumn leaves on the trees I admire as I curl up in my chair with my blanket
This, is my perfection.
